    Time Warner makes you get Digital Cable to get access to League Pass. Out here in California, they let us break that $160 into 4 monthly payments of $40 to make it easy to purchase. To get NBATV, they also force you to purchase a Sports Package as well. So does Direct TV.
    I'd pay close to $200 to get 95% of the games because that is the only way, I'll be able to watch Silver & Black on a regular basis.
